Position Summary:

  • Ampcus is seeking an experienced detail-oriented and highly-organized Technical Writer to support documentation efforts for AI initiatives at a leading independent federal agency focused on financial system stability.
  • This role will be responsible for producing clear accurate and user-friendly documentation that supports the development deployment and adoption of AI technologiesincluding Agentic AI Generative AI (GenAI) and traditional ML systems.
  • The Technical Writer will collaborate with cross-functional teams to translate complex technical concepts into accessible materials for diverse audiences including developers analysts policy staff and leadership.
Key Responsibilities:
  • Documentation Development
    • Create and maintain program management and technical documentation for AI platforms models APIs workflows and infrastructure components.
    • Develop policies procedures/SOPs user guides system manuals and onboarding materials for GenAI and Agentic AI tools.
    • Write clear and concise content that supports training change management and governance efforts.
  • Collaboration & Content Gathering
    • Work closely with program manager AI/ML architects AI/ML engineers developers and program stakeholders to gather source material and clarify requirements.
    • Participate in product demos sprint reviews and technical discussions to stay informed of system updates and changes.
    • Translate technical jargon into plain language for non-technical audiences while preserving accuracy.
  • Quality & Consistency
    • Ensure documentation adheres to federal standards for accessibility (Section 508) security and compliance.
    • Maintain version control and documentation repositories using tools like Confluence SharePoint or Git.
    • Review and edit content for clarity grammar formatting and consistency across deliverables.
  • Support for AI Adoption
    • Contribute to internal knowledge bases FAQs and quick-reference materials to support AI literacy and responsible use.
    • Assist in the development of communication materials that explain AI capabilities risks and governance policies.
    • Support reporting and strategic communications as needed.
